Rebecca's Private Idaho — 3D Route Visualiser

Stage 3 main event (8:30am start) — the short course, a taste of the event without the full mileage.

How to use the map
  • Plan — the route laid out on a 2D map, drag the slider under the map to travel along it.
  • 3D View — the same route over real 3D terrain relief.
  • Wedge — a side-on profile of the route, showing gradient as a rising/falling wedge.
  • Whichever view is open, dragging the slider moves you along the route — the gradient, distance and elevation readouts update live as you go.
How to use Setup & Gears
  • Setup — enter your groupset, weight, power and cadence. Shared with the Gear Calculator, Climb Planner and every climb page.
  • Gears — shows which of your gears are achievable at the current gradient as you drag the slider on the map.
  • Switch to Setup first if you haven't entered a groupset yet — Gears needs it to work out achievability.
